42. e to a Monitoring Centre via the telephone The transmission is done using DTMF tones 14 digits are sent to report an alarm The format is as follows SSSS QE SSSS 4 digit subscriber ID Client Account Number Q Event qualifier 9 Channels Channels 1 8 indicate the status of the 8 reporting channels Each channel may have the following values 1 New alarm 3 Restore 5 Normal 6 Previously reported event Channel 9 indicates the type of event Channel 9 may have the following values Extra Alarms 5 Zone Trouble 6 System Alarms 7 Zone Alarm 9 Test Therefore Channel 9 determines what channels 1 8 mean E Error check Channel 9 15 5 6 y 9 Channel 1 DET1 HELP P1 LOW AC POWER CALLP 1 none Channel 2 DET2 HELP P2 LOW BATTP2 LOW BATT CALL P 2 none Channel 3 DET2 HELP P3 LOW CALL P3 none Channel 4 DET4 HELP P4 LOW CALL P 4 none Channel 5 DETS HELP P5 INI LOW BATTP5 none 5 Channel 6 DET6 HELP P6 IN2 LOW P6 CALL P 6 none Channel 7 DET7 HELP P6 IN3 INACTIVITY LOW 7 CALL P 7 none Channel 8 DETS HELP P8 INA LOW BATT P8 CALL P 8 none Note Depending upon the program option in the System 5 Main Menu Option and the Medi Link Help Red Button Reporting Channel HE the main unit HELP will double up on the same Channel of a programmed Radio Key HELP Medi Link Installati

45. every 24 hours During Mains Fail a static battery voltage test is done at similar intervals as Line Fail NOTE When replacing the Medi Link unit batteries Mains should be left ON or else the timers will be reset Medi Link Installation Manual Rev1 1 6 6 PRE ALARM ENTRY TIME and EXIT TIME PRE ALARM TIME allows a time between a Radio Pendant Detector triggering and Medi Link unit alarming ENTRY TIME allows a time from activating a detector till DISARM During Entry Delay the siren will chirp once a second When the OFF Button is pressed the speaker beeps 3 times to indicate DISARMED If the OFF Button is not pressed within the Entry Delay an alarm is generated EXIT TIME allows a time from pressing the ON Button on a Radio Key Pendant until ARMED The speaker will beep once when the ON Button on a Radio Key Pendant is pressed to indicate Exit Delay start and beep once at exit delay end to indicate ARMED 6 7 ALARM LOCKOUT The Medi Link unit inhibits multiple activations of the same alarm ie the Open Collect Outputs OUTPUTS No 1 OUTPUTS No 3 will not turn on again or the Medi Link unit will not report same alarm during the particular ARMED session when LOCKOUT programming option is Enabled NOTE Lockout does not apply to PANIC DURESS or DEMENTIA alarms or any Detectors with the FIRE or INACTIVITY option Lockout will also effect the Radio transmitted message as well 6 8

56. on Manual Rev1 1 7 2 CONTACT ID REPORTING This reporting is used to transmit alarms from a subscriber s site to a Monitoring Centre via the telephone The transmission is done using DTMF tones 14 digits are sent to report an alarm The format is as follows SSSS 18 Q XYZ GG CCC E SSSS 4 digit subscriber ID Client Account Number 18 Uniquely identifies this format as Contact ID Q Event qualifier New alarm 3 Restore XYZ Event code see table GG Group code always 00 CCC E Error check Program Option Detector Alarms Detector Alarm Option Alarm Detector Home Mode Option Home Detector Fire Option Fire Detector Silent Option Silent Tamper Alarms Detector Tamper Panic Alarms Help Button on Medi Call unit Hardwired Inputs No 1 to No 4 Radio Keys Option Panic or Answer Radio Keys Option Delay Panic Radio Keys Option Duress Other Alarms Supervision Option Supervisory Inactivity Detectors Option Inactivity Dementia Keys Option Dementia Mains Fail Main unit Low Battery Detectors Low Battery Radio Keys Pendants Low Battery Open Close Reports Auto Exclude Reed Switch only Test Call Zone or sensor number or user ID for Open Close reports Event Code XYZ 130 Burglary 131 Perimeter 133 24 hour 130 Burglary 383 Tamper 120 Panic Alarm 120 Panic Alarm 120 Panic Alarm 100 Medical Alarm 121 D

64. rt an inactivity event 6 2 UNIT HELP RED BUTTON The alarm is processed exactly the same as the Radio Key Pendant Alarms Ademco Version The HELP Red Button initiates an Emergency or Call Alarm Contact ID Version The HELP Red Button initiates a Panic 120 Alarm British DTMF Version The Help Red Button initiates a Code 1 6 3 INPUTS NO 1 TO NO 4 The Inputs Input No 1 to No 4 are normally open and when one becomes shorted to common it generates an alarm Ademco Version Inputs No 1 to No 4 initiates an Emergency or Call Alarm with the exception that Inputs No 1 to No 4 will be displayed and reported to Monitoring Centre on Channels 5 6 7 and 8 Contact ID Version Inputs No 1 to No 4 initiates a Panic 120 Alarm with the exception that Inputs No 1 to No 4 will be displayed and reported to Monitoring Centre on Zone 21 22 23 and 24 British DTMF Version Inputs No 1 to No 3 initiates a Code or E and Input No 4 initiates a Code 3 6 4 MAINS FAIL Mains On Light Flashing When a MAINS FAIL is detected the MAINS ON Light will flash When a Mains Fail of duration greater than 10 seconds is detected the Medi Link unit will annunciate an AC power fail message The message is chime Power to your unit is disconnected Please check powerpoint connections and switch The message will be repeated again in 20 seconds if Mains Fail persists When the Mains Fail is Restored the Medi Link unit will annunciate an A
